@charset "UTF-8";label{background-color:transparent;color:#32bb99;display:block;font-weight:400;margin-bottom:0;margin-top:.75rem}.input-validation-error{border:2px solid #bb3299!important}.input-required{border-left:.5rem solid #32bb99}.field-validation-error{color:#bb3299;display:block;font-size:1rem}.validation-summary-errors{border:2px solid;color:#bb3299;font-size:1rem;margin:10px 0;padding:10px 10px 10px 50px}.validation-summary-valid{display:none}.msg-error,.msg-info,.msg-question,.msg-success,.msg-validation,.msg-warning{border:2px solid;padding:10px 10px 10px 50px;position:relative}.msg-error:before,.msg-info:before,.msg-question:before,.msg-success:before,.msg-validation:before,.msg-warning:before{font-family:bootstrap-icons,sans-serif;speak:none;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;content:"";display:inline-block;font-size:2.25rem;height:2.25rem;left:5px;position:absolute;text-align:center;top:5px;vertical-align:middle;width:2.25rem}.msg-error p,.msg-error ul,.msg-info p,.msg-info ul,.msg-question p,.msg-question ul,.msg-success p,.msg-success ul,.msg-validation p,.msg-validation ul,.msg-warning p,.msg-warning ul{margin-bottom:0}.msg-error-text{color:#bb3299}.msg-info{background-color:#ebf5f8;color:#3299bb}.msg-info:before{content:"\f431"}.msg-success{background-color:#ebf8f5;color:#32bb99}.msg-success:before{content:"\f26b"}.msg-warning{background-color:#fff6e6;color:orange}.msg-warning:before{content:"\f333"}.msg-question{background-color:#ebf5f8;color:#3299bb}.msg-question:before{content:"\f505"}.msg-error{background-color:#f8ebf5;color:#bb3299}.msg-error:before{content:"\f623"}.msg-validation{background-color:#f8ebf5;color:#bb3299}.msg-validation:before{content:"\f333"}.form-control{font-size:1.25rem;padding:.25rem .5rem}.bootstrap-select>button.btn{background-color:#fff!important;border-color:#ced4da;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Noto Sans,Liberation Sans,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ol,Noto Color Emoji}body{margin:0 auto;max-width:60rem}body footer.site,body header.site{background-color:#e9e9e9;margin-top:.3rem}body header.site{background-image:url(/images/volleyball-turnier-logo.png);background-position:99%;background-repeat:no-repeat;margin-bottom:.5rem;margin-top:.5rem;padding:.5rem 1rem}body footer.site{margin-bottom:.3rem;margin-top:.5rem}body footer.site div{font-size:.75rem;padding:.1rem .5rem;text-align:right}#nav-main{background-color:#3299bb;font-size:1.3rem;margin-top:.25rem;padding-bottom:0;padding-top:0}#content{background-color:#fff;font-size:1.2rem;margin-top:.3rem;padding-top:.8rem}a.link:before{content:"➞ "}.h1,.h2,.h3{font-weight:700}.h1,.h2,.h3,.h4,.h5{color:#32bb99}hr{border:0;border-top:.1rem solid #32bb99;height:0}fieldset{background-color:#f8f9fa;border:.1rem solid #3299bb;margin:.5rem 0;padding:0 .5rem 1rem}fieldset legend{background-color:#3299bb;color:#fff;float:none!important;font-size:.9rem;padding:0 .5rem}#tournaments-table{border:1px solid #adb5bd;font-size:1rem;margin-bottom:.5rem;width:100%}#tournaments-table th{background-color:#e0f0f5;color:#000}#single-tournament-table{font-size:1rem;line-height:1.5;margin:1rem 0}#single-tournament-table td,#single-tournament-table th{display:table-cell;padding:.5rem;text-align:left;vertical-align:top}#single-tournament-table th{text-align:left;vertical-align:top}.bi-1x{font-size:1em}.bi-2x{font-size:2em}.bi-3x{font-size:3em}.bi-4x{font-size:4em}.bi-5x{font-size:5em}.bi-6x{font-size:6em}.bi-7x{font-size:7em}.bi-8x{font-size:8em}.bi-9x{font-size:9em}.bi-10x{font-size:10em}.bi-2xs{font-size:.625em;line-height:.1em;vertical-align:.225em}.bi-xs{font-size:.75em;line-height:.08333em;vertical-align:.125em}.bi-sm{font-size:.875em;line-height:.07143em;vertical-align:.05357em}.bi-lg{font-size:1.25em;line-height:.05em;vertical-align:-.075em}.bi-xl{font-size:1.5em;line-height:.04167em;vertical-align:-.125em}.bi-2xl{font-size:2em;line-height:.03125em;vertical-align:-.1875em}
/*# sourceMappingURL=maps/site.min.css.map */